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Allen s Swamp Monkey | leaf coral |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Cnidaria (Cnidarians)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Anthozoa |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Scleractinia (Scleractinia) |
| Family |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) | Acroporidae |
| Genus | Allenopithecus | Montipora |
| Species | Allenopithecus nigroviridis | Montipora foliosa |
